Highlights: • Haiti’s FY21 work plan package was submitted to USAID on August 13th, 2020. • The MSPP submitted the Joint Reporting Form (JRF) and Epidemiological Data Reporting Form (EPIRF) to PAHO. • Procurement of ▇▇▇▇▇ MDA materials (cups and t-shirts) and materials for TAS in Dondon EU is ongoing and expected to be completed in early September. The MDA materials will be stored at the IMA warehouse in preparation for MDA in ▇▇▇▇▇ commune in FY21. • The Northwest FAA agreement has been terminated based on the cancellation of the Port-de- Paix MDA. The terminated FAA agreement will be shared with the MSPP departmental director for signature in September. • Act | East submitted an activity restart package to USAID to conduct community based TAS in Dondon EU in September. This included adapting TAS training slides with COVID-19 risk mitigation precautions as well as development of standard operating procedures. • IMA Act | East supported the MSPP to respond to feedback from the RPRG on Haiti’s TAS approval request for TAS in Dondon and Cabaret. Responses were shared with the HNTDCP focal point, who in turn submitted to PAHO for review and approval. HNTDCP received feedback from PAHO in early September, approving TAS in all of Dondon and part of Cabaret.
